So I went in for an oil change today to one of my respectable mechanics and I was told that I have a very small leak in my transmission I think he said from the seal. He told me it wasn't something to worry about only if I noticed big losses in the fluid. Anyone else have any input on this about if I should be really concerned? I don't know if I should wait to see if it gets worse or to get it fixed asap so I don't end up making things worse frown.gif For now I'm going to keep a close eye on it via my garage floor kindasad.gif

keep a close eye on it, check the levels, see if there is a difference from day to day, week to week, etc. when its gets real bad, begin planning to repair. My celi has an oil leak for 3 years now. I check the oil all the time, it pretty much stays full until the next oil change so small loss of oil for 3-4 months. Of course if you have the money or the labor to do it, I'd repair it immediately.
